Organizations needed effective tools to address workplace health issues, which were causing an average of 38.9 days of absence per case. The challenge was to create an intuitive interface for a comprehensive health platform that could efficiently survey employees, provide analytics with forecasting capabilities, and deliver tailored advice to diverse organizations from large corporations to mid-sized companies.

The HealthVision platform design focused on creating an accessible health management system with consistent brand identity throughout the user journey. Interface layers were developed serving diverse stakeholders from HR managers to employees while maintaining platform cohesion and visual brand language. The psy50 survey featured a branded interface completable in just 7.3 minutes, emphasizing clarity and recognizable design elements for accurate data collection.
Visualization patterns transformed complex health metrics into immediately understandable insights, presenting benchmarks, trends and forecasts through a cohesive, brand-aligned visual system. The reporting interfaces connected survey findings with actionable recommendations while reinforcing HealthVision's trusted visual identity, guiding users from problem identification to solution implementation.
